10th House Of Reps ‘Nonpareil’, Why We Are Supporting Tinubu Administration-Deputy Spokesman

Having gotten recognized as a perfect model, the  10th House of Representatives  cannot be compared to previous legislative sessions, Deputy Spokesman for  the House of Representatives, Philip Agbese, has said.

Team@orientactualmags.com learned that Agbese said this in Abuja on Sunday while reacting to  the comments made about the salary and allowances of the federal lawmakers by former president Olusegun Obasanjo.

The former president had submitted that it is wrong and absurd that the federal lawmakers are allowed to determine their salary and allowances .

‘You are not supposed to fix your salary or allowances; it is supposed to be done by the Revenue Mobilisation and Fiscal Responsibility Commission.

With all due respect, you know it’s not right; it is not right for me to be the one to determine what I pay myself; it is immoral, and you are doing it; the Senate is doing it’ Obasanjo had submitted.

Rep Agbese however said unlike what was the situation in the past, the House of Representatives has maintained the highest level of accountability and transparency  under Speaker Tajudeen Abass’ leadership

‘I am bold to say that the very respected former president is right and wrong because of the things that transpired between him and the National Assembly during his time as president.

Stories abound that he was helpless. This is no longer the case, as the current crop of representatives has done quite a lot to deliver to the poor masses.

We mean what we say and everything that we do as a parliament. The era of narrow interest is over. We are here for our people and their collective interests’ he said.

Agbese also denied allegations that N100m and N200m  were  given to members of the National Assembly, noting that no such thing happened under the current administration  headed by President Bola Tinubu.

Asiwaju Bola Tinubu,  he noted,  is different from all past presidents in so many ways, and he has been  getting their support out of sheer diplomacy and consultation.

‘Tinubu is a product of partnership and collaboration. I think Obasanjo should focus more on the traditional media and stop patronizing social media hoaxes.

We know what Tinubu wants for Nigeria, and supporting the President to deliver on the Renewed Hope Agenda is the best for the country’ he added.

 Speaker Tajudeen Abass  has , also ,according to him,  been largely accountable to the people and he has remained a torchbearer of the parliament.

‘Abbas has earned the respect of members not just because he is a kind and God-fearing man, but because he strives daily for excellence.

Obasanjo tried, albeit unsuccessfully, to bribe members of the National Assembly in his time to support positions that were not in line with the Constitution.

That informed his decision to amend the Constitution through the backdoor, which was rejected by the majority’ he submitted while adding that this  had also shown that apart from the few bad eggs that the former President had in the parliament as collaborators, the majority were still men and women of good conscience who could not sell their country for a pot of porridge.

He also said some former leaders are envious of the excellent  relationship between the executive and the legislature because President Bola Tinubu  has not considered working towards removing  national assembly leaders like it was done in the past.  .

 ‘They are not happy that Abbas is not like Ghali Na’Abba and the President is making progress to salvage the situation’ he submitted.
